Title:

Allothermal Steam Gasification with Biological Methanation: Bio Methane from Lignocellulosic Feedstock

Abstract:

The Chair of Energy Process Engineering at FAU Erlangen-Nuremberg, the German Start-up company MicroPyros GmbH and the Fraunhofer UMSICHT institute jointly investigate a novel approach of producing bio methane within the research project “Ash-to-Gas”. In cooperation with the project partners, a mobile fermenter shall be built and coupled to an allothermal steam gasifier. The sustenance of the microorganisms shall be carried out either by leading the ash particles from the gasifier directly into the fermenter or after performing various purification processes.With this set-up, methanogenesis shall adapt step by step to the conditions of using lignocellulosic feedstock in the gasifier. The experiments shall use wood, straw and roadside vegetation. Under realistic conditions it shall be measured, how much carbon monoxide, carbon dioxide and hydrocarbons (including tar) can be converted respectively tolerated. Another objective is to find out, whether ash particles can supply nutrients to the microorganisms in a sufficient way.
